The beginning of the heroic defence of Leningrad from the German invaders is now available in the Presidential Library’s historical materials

8 September 2018
"We have been thoroughly entrenched here and gradually narrowing the fascists from the city. Life in the city is difficult - but you need to survive, if we do not want to die from the fascist cannibals. This is what the majority of the city's population thinks", - Vasily Sokolov, a townsman, wrote to his family in the autumn of 1941 from the besieged Leningrad. 77 years ago on September 8, the city on the Neva was surrounded by invader troops and was cut off from the rest of the country.
